Aquatic bliss
It’s a shared dream: to wear garments so stylish that they draw in the kind of enthralled passers-by usually found at the tourist attractions of the Dubai Mall. Well, how about becoming one of those tourist attractions? The new Aquarium Collection from dunhill is the answer. Inspired by some iconic aquarium-style lighters taken from the brand’s archives, this is one of its biggest launches of 2019. Vintage is very much “in right now”, as the kids say, so we’re ecstatic about this new drop from dunhill. The Dubai Aquarium is no match for such artful attire.
The collection is characterised by intricate underwater illustrations on bold backdrops. Salmon pink and algae green pieces provide a more pastel palette, while the azure of other garments promises a perfect pop of colour. This is statement-making at its most refined.
Creative Director Mark Weston has really outdone himself when it comes to the shirts, shorts and accessories in this capsule. The classic two-in-one makes a comeback with reversible bomber jackets (a.k.a: a built-in outfit change so the Insta pics can keep flowing). For another nod to street style, nab yourself a belt bag (the perfect mixture of practicality and style that will make your dad proud) or a casual drawstring backpack for on-the-go.
Whether you’re searching for the finishing touch or an entire outfit, these stunning prints will help you achieve that effortless look.
Originally launched in 1949, the exclusive, hand-painted lighters that inspired the design remain a favourite among collectors, and if you really can’t get enough of these marine motifs, you’ll be delighted to know that a limited edition set of 15 lighters, each engraved and numbered, will accompany the collection for you to complete your look. Slick and stylish
The COS Summer Party Edit takes a sartorial voyage through the elements and is designed to transition from open-air gatherings to Eid celebrations at sundown. Quite simply, your clobber should suit pretty much every occasion.
Each piece is designed with a fresh and effortless elegance resonant of the movement and qualities of water and air. For menswear, the season’s inspirations translate into tailored fluidity epitomised by wool trousers with side folds that open when you walk, allowing for ease of movement.
The deconstructed blazer is reworked in a lightweight fabric, and you will be able to breeze through Eid with a range of light-weight styles including cotton and linen that work seamlessly for both daytime outings and nighttime gatherings.
The menswear parachute ripstop bag is designed for functionality while rounded leather sandals with a knot complete the season’s look.
Fast fashion
We’ve all slopped a bit of pizza down our front at one time or another, and now any stray slices of pepperoni will just blend right in.
Philipp Plein’s new Pizza Boy capsule collection is here and it’s piping hot and ready to devour.
Not only does the punk-renegade inspired style combine our love for fashion and fast food, it also means any rogue pizza toppings can be stored safely on your person for later consumption.
The T-shirts, hoodies and joggers are adorned with patchworks and prints, with each piece being expertly crafted in Italy.
And like any good pizza, it’s not going to last long. The latest drop has a limited number of pieces available and once it’s gone, it’s gone.

German designer Philipp Plein founded his namesake luxury fashion brand in 2008. Based in Switzerland, the collection is distinguished by an unconventional and non-conformist style combined with impeccable craftsmanship.
